DRAIN ASSEMBLY

(Model 4802 only)

Apply a bead of PUTTY around underside of DRAIN PLUG flange. Insert DRAIN PLUG into SINK drain hole.

Hold DRAIN PLUG to prevent turning and assemble GASKET, WASHER, and LOCKNUT, from underneath sink.

Insert threaded end of TAILPIECE into lower end of DRAIN PLUG. Connect other end to trap.

4 INSTALL POP-UP DRAIN

Push TAILPIECE down into TRAP (threaded end up).

Thread LOCKNUT, WASHER and GASKET onto DRAIN BODY.

Apply a bead of PUTTY to underside of FLANGE.

Position EXTENSION ROD onto POP-UP ROD and tighten THUMBSCREW.

Remove one end of CLIP from PIVOT ROD by squeezing ends together while sliding.

Insert PIVOT ROD into second or third hole in EXTENSION and reassemble CLIP. (EXTENSION may need to be bent.)

Adjust STOPPER height by repositioning EXTENSION and tightening THUMBSCREW.

5 TEST INSTALLED FAUCET

Remove AERATOR.

With handle in OFF position, turn on water supplies and check all connections for leaks.

Operate both handles to flush water lines thoroughly. Check spout mounting and hose connections for leaks.

Operate LIFT ROD and check DRAIN for leaks.

Turn handles into OFF position and replace AERATOR.

Plastic SCREEN in CARTRIDGE may accumulate dirt causing reduced water flow. To clean, first turn off hot and cold water supplies, then:

Remove INSERT and HANDLE SCREW. Slip HANDLE with ADAPTER off. Unscrew CARTRIDGE with wrench. Thoroughly rinse plastic SCREEN at base of CARTRIDGE.
